HP Fortran v2.9 for HP-UX 11i v2 Release Note*5991-0697*
HP Fortran for HP-UX v2.9
Previous Fixes
Chapter 1 31
• An enhancement was made for +DD64 technical applications.
PHSS_29295 (11.22)
• Oversubscripting of common array (invalid source) yielded wrong answers at high
optimization levels.
• Wrong answers were received at +O3.
• There were issues with POINTER arrays.
•Declaring_F90_F_STOP did not return.
• SPECcpu2000 code failed to collect flow.data file.
• Performance loss of implementation of a matrix multiplication.
• There was an internal compiler error with OMP PARALLEL PPRIVATE equivance.
• A module declared zero size aborts with +DD64.
PHSS_28914 (11.22)
• FORM=UNFORMATTED did not handle big/little-endian conversion.
• Occasionally, there was an assert on ICUP.
• wdb did not find local variables with ‘info locals’.
PHSS_28697 (11.22)
• Occasionally, the compiler would abort due to emitting DSTRUCTON.
• There were incorrect Caliper line numbers for +O2 -g.
• There were incorrect offsets for vax structures.
• Occasionally, the compiler rejected *size(dimension) declarations.
PHSS_28560
• Performance was degraded (by 2-4x) when the no parms overlap assertion was no longer
present.
• There was a memory leak in the application program.
• An error—*bad stackf90—occurred with +Oopenmp.